Course Details


• Understanding Mental Health Disclosures
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Mental Health Disclosures
• Creating a Supportive Workplace Culture for Mental Health Disclosures
• Effective Communication Strategies for Mental Health Disclosures
• Managing Stigma and Discrimination in Mental Health Disclosures
• Developing Accommodation Policies and Procedures for Mental Health Disclosures
• Best Practices for Confidentiality in Mental Health Disclosures
• Mental Health Training for Managers and Supervisors
• Implementing a Comprehensive Mental Health Disclosure Program
• Evaluating and Improving Mental Health Disclosure Policies and Practices

The chart below displays job market trends for mental health disclosure management roles in the UK, presenting the percentage of individuals employed in each role. 1. **Mental Health Professional** (45%): With a primary focus on mental health, these professionals provide support, treatment, and guidance for individuals dealing with mental health concerns. 2. **HR Manager** (25%): HR managers play a crucial role in managing mental health disclosures within organizations. They ensure policy compliance, offer support, and facilitate necessary accommodations. 3. **Team Leader/Manager** (15%): Team leaders and managers must address mental health disclosures in the workplace by fostering open communication, promoting mental well-being, and providing accommodation. 4. **Counselor** (10%): Counselors typically work in educational settings or private practices, providing mental health assessments and interventions. 5. **Other** (5%): This category includes roles such as mental health trainers, advocates, and consultants, who contribute to mental health awareness and support.
